Operational Security and Compliance in Critical Environments

Maintaining the highest levels of operational security and compliance is non-negotiable in hyperscale data center projects. Our teams are accustomed to working within highly controlled environments, often requiring background checks, specific badging, and adherence to client-specific physical and logical security protocols (e.g., SOC 2, HIPAA, PCI DSS). All personnel are trained on data center best practices for hot/cold aisle containment, preventing contamination from dust or debris, and working safely around live equipment, including adherence to LOTO (lockout/tagout) procedures when required. Cable routing and pathway design incorporate physical separation requirements to prevent unauthorized access or accidental disruption. Furthermore, all installations are performed in strict accordance with the National Electrical Code (NEC), NFPA 75 (Standard for the Fire Protection of Information Technology Equipment), and local building codes. This includes proper grounding and bonding of all conductive elements, fire-rated pathway penetrations, and management of cable bundles to prevent overheating or fire hazards. Precision Installation & Deployment in Live Environments

Hyperscale deployments often occur in live or rapidly expanding data center environments, demanding a highly disciplined and minimally intrusive installation methodology. Our certified technicians execute installations with surgical precision, adhering to strict Method of Procedure (MOP) documentation developed in partnership with client operations teams. This includes detailed cable routing diagrams, labeling conventions compliant with TIA-606-C, and precise termination sequences for MPO/MTP connectors to ensure correct polarity and fiber mapping for SR4/SR8/SR16 deployments. Our teams are proficient in installing massive quantities of pre-terminated fiber optic assemblies, reducing on-site termination time and improving consistency. Overhead and under-floor cable tray systems (basket tray, ladder rack) are installed to maintain proper bend radii, load bearing capacity, and separation from power cabling in accordance with NEC Articles 770 and 800. We implement meticulous firestopping solutions at all pathway penetrations as per code, preventing propagation through the data center. Every cable run, patch panel, and distribution frame is precisely labeled using industrial-grade, machine-printed identifiers, facilitating rapid troubleshooting and future modifications, significantly reducing operational expenditure related to MACs.

What documentation do we get at the end of a Burbank Hyperscale Data Center Cabling install?+

Every Burbank project closes with Fluke DSX (or OTDR for fiber) certification reports for every port, a TIA-606-B labeled patch schedule, redlined as-built drawings, rack elevations, warranty registration, and a MAC-ready cabling database. Your IT team can pick it up cold on day one.

Can existing cable be reused during a Hyperscale Data Center Cabling refresh in Burbank?+

Sometimes. On Burbank refresh projects we Fluke-test the existing plant first: if runs pass CAT6 or CAT6A channel spec and pathways are clean, they stay. Anything failing certification, abandoned per NEC 800.25, or unlabeled gets removed and replaced. You get a channel-by-channel keep/replace decision — not a blanket rip-and-replace bill.
